Transaction eb384dcdc3f51f79be11587c31735aed4ddb83763c6854d51782a92d3b19b651
1 Input
1 Output
-
eb384dcdc3f51f79be11587c31735aed4ddb83763c6854d51782a92d3b19b651:0
- value
- 1765426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 344ce9381552e5e6b4e875ae3ecb7363aca57881 OP_EQUAL
- address
- 36TZCPZKZkrBEAjSY7Efp2W7JMoGwvZPAF